<div xmlns="http://www.w3.org/1999/xhtml"><p><a href="http://www.abcnews.go.com/International/wireStory?id=4413691">ABC.news and the AP Newswire</a> has a great story about WWII veteran Fred Hargesheimer who was shot down over New Guinea on June 5, 1943.&nbsp; He survived without being captured by the Japanese with the help of local villagers.&nbsp; After the war he returned in the 1960s and eventually helped build a school that has helped the region flourish.</p>
